Description
A full-time, nine-month tenure-track faculty position which provides instruction to undergraduate and graduate nursing students, with a primary focus on medical-surgical nursing and additional specialty areas such as pediatrics, obstetrics, and mental health.
Teaches in classroom, clinical, laboratory, and simulation settings; facilitates student learning through evidence-based instructional strategies; and manages student coursework and communication through online learning platforms.
Develops and maintains an active program of scholarship that contributes to the advancement of the discipline, including conducting research, publishing in peer-reviewed journals, pursuing external funding opportunities, and disseminating findings through professional presentations.
Also participates in service activities that support the mission of the department, college, and university, such as mentoring students, contributing to curriculum development, and engaging with the professional community.
Maintains an active research agenda with demonstrated progression. Engages in research-related professional development and works toward dissemination through presentations and peer-reviewed publication.
